## Runbook: Gaugepile Sidecar — Release Checklist

Heads up: the sidecar ships with every app pod, so a bad config fans out fast. Before cutting a release, confirm the flush interval hasn't drifted from what the Tallyhouse aggregator expects, or you'll see sawtooth gaps in dashboards. Rollbacks are cheap — just repin the image tag. Canary one node pool first, watch for ten minutes, then proceed. The values to verify against are these.

config for bagep-yafof:
quenath:
  pin: 8584
  metrics_host: metrics.quenath.tolvaqsys.internal
  tenant: pelath
  seal: seal_ed102645

## Configuration

Hey on-call — the tax-rate lookup cache (codename Bramblebox) keeps hot jurisdiction rates in memory so we don't hammer the Ratherly rates service on every checkout. Tune it with `BRAMBLE_CACHE_TTL_SECONDS` (default 900) and `BRAMBLE_MAX_ENTRIES` (default 10000). If you see stale-rate alerts, drop the TTL rather than flushing manually; flushes cause a thundering herd. The cache warms itself on boot by pulling the full rate table, and that pull needs to authenticate, so make sure the env file includes this line:

secret setting of hawep-yahig: LEDGER_TOKEN29=41b5d6315371c92885eaeb077fb63

14:22 — Confirmed the leak in the Pondscape image cache: decoded thumbnails from third-party plugins were pinned by a stale weak-reference table and never evicted. Heap grew ~40 MB/hour on the Brightmoor fleet. Mitigation: forced cache flush and capped plugin-originated entries at 512. Plugin authors should verify release hooks fire on unload. The affected build is identified by the token below.

pipeline stamp: htk21_104c5ba7d0df6b2897cd5

### v3.2.0 — Renamed setting

Keyspindle no longer reads `KS_ROTATE_TOKEN`; it was renamed for consistency with the plugin API. Plugins targeting 3.2+ must use the new name or rotation hooks will not fire. The old name is ignored silently — no deprecation warning is emitted. Update your `.env` before upgrading. Keep `KS_PLUGIN_DIR` and `KS_LOG_LEVEL` as-is. Immediately after those entries, add the renamed token line with your existing value.

secret setting of kawif-kajef: COURIER_KEY3=d2b